What are the steps that the allied health professional can take to ensure the calculation and measurement of the desired dose ar

e done correctly?
Biology
2 answers:
MissTica3 years ago
4 0

Answer:

<u>Allied health professional:</u>

To provide the best of medical facilities like diagnostic, technological, and other related services to the patients in the various institutes or hospitals, the allied health  professional look for the optimum amount of drugs and the healthy procedure to consume such medications.

But, there are few steps which the allied health professional must consider before proceeding to the diagnoses of the patients, these steps are as follows:

Steps that are followed:

  1. <u>The Analyses of the drugs and test check:</u>The professional must check it first that the drug which is under consideration for medication purpose has the right amount or level of elements in it.
  2. <u>Finding the best route for medication:</u> The professional must consider to know about the best route of the medicines intake by the patients, as it can be through a vaccine or can be consumed orally by the patients medical and psychological conditions. As mostly the drugs are consumed orally as prescribed by the professional.
  3. <u>Consumption of the right amount of drugs:</u>The professional must make it sure to analyze and prescribe the right amount of dose in order to avoid any medical imbalance or disorder due to unchecked amount of dose consumed by the patient.
  4. <u>Monitoring the drugs consumed:</u>After the professional has prescribed the different level of drugs as according to the patients need then there are few test done after that and symptoms of the doses taken are analyzed to make it sure that all is well for the patient.

Mature trna has an amino acid binding site at one end and the other end interacts with the mrna by complementary base pairing du
swat32
<span>Mature tRNA has an amino acid binding site at one end and the other end interacts with the mRNA by complementary base pairing due to the presence of an anticodon. An anticodon is a three nucleotide sequence which is complementary to the triplet codon of mRNA which specifies a protein for synthesis.</span>
